TRADES UNION CONGRESS
CONFERS WITH RAILWAYMEN.
LONDON, 19th January. • The General! Council of the Trades Union Congress and representatives of the railwaymen's organisations held a conference last night and adjourned till to-day. The secretary of the council stated that the situation is delicate, and that he would rather not say whether there was any hope of settlement.
